Brandon Sandersons Mistborn coming to gaming life from Orbit

Some really exciting news for any fans of the Fantasy genre in general and a real treat, as Little Orbit have announced they will be bringing the well respected and award winning author Brandon Sandersons epic fantasy Mistborn to gaming life in 2013 for XBox 360, PS3 and PC/MAC formats. The Mistborn World is one of ash, mist and dark gothic fantasy creations who are all under the rule of the immortal Lord Ruler. The individuals follow a unique and powerful rule based magic system known as Allomancy that allows them to temporarily increase mental and physical abilities by ingesting and burning metal flakes. The Mistings can only ingest one metal while the Mistborn are capable of devouring and utilising multiple metal components.

The upcoming RPG is a completely new and original storyline set hundereds of years before the Mistborn saga and will have a large focus on the unique combat system that melds Allomancy into the hands of gamers. Players take on the role of Fendin Fiddle Fathvell, an arrogant young man who must learn the art of Allomancy as quickly as possible to engage and beat the evil forces trying to destroy his family. “I’m a huge fan of the series, and I cannot wait to get this into the hands of gamers,” said Matthew Scott, CEO of Little Orbit.  “Between the distinctive magic system, the story twists Brandon has planned for the game, and the rich depth of character skills, we’re creating something very unique for players to enjoy.”

Brandon Sanderson has an inspirational work ethic, and is no stranger to the video game industry having recently finished the story development for Infinity Blade 2 as well as the accompanying novella. Additionally, in between working on his own projects in the form of Mistborn and the Stormlight novels, he was chosen by Robert Jordans wife to complete the Wheel of Time series after Jordan passed away before completing the saga.
